CHARTtrack: Postdata's "Tobias Grey"

Postdata is Wintersleep member Paul Murphy's new acoustic project with his brother, Michael Smith. "Tobias Grey" appears on their self-titled debut album, which is out now. Postdata was inspired by dreams Paul Murphy had after his grandparents passed away, and was written in Yarmouth, N.S. and Halifax.
